Staten Island is a unique place where people with intellectual and developmental disabilities have a range of supports and providers to evaluate when selecting services for their family and those under their care. Staten Island Disability News, a monthly program on Community Media of Staten Island (Spectrum Channel 34), seeks to demystify these options and bring to light new developments from the field.
Created in partnership with Constructive Partnerships (CP) Unlimited, a leading provider of supports for people with I/DD since 1946, Staten Island Disability News features a range of prominent guests and experts from throughout Staten Island and the greater New York City area who can contextualize and inform a diverse audience about innovative programs for the I/DD community and beyond. Additionally, the monthly program serves as a platform for cultural institutions to share educational opportunities for people with disabilities.

Episode 2: Maintaining Mobility and Movement [aired: November 2023]
Watch Online:

Summary:
This second episode explores the topics of Mobility and Movement, as it connects to people with intellectual and developmental disabilities- specifically, how do you get people who in many ways have limited movement, to perform everyday tasks? What are innovative approaches to empowering and strengthening both the body and spirit? What we hope is that by the end of this episode, you will come away more confident to grow both perspectives and muscles.
Guests:
Melissa D’Accordo, Ph.D., Curriculum & Training Specialist, CP Unlimited
Zach Huleatt, Director of Research and Development, Rifton Equipment
Maryann Virga,Parent Advocate
Nicolina Dante, Kindful Movement Instructor
Episode 1: I/DD Resources on the Island [aired: October 2023]
Watch Online:

Summary:
This initial episode is intended to provide an uncomplicated picture from above: What is offered on Staten Island within the CP Unlimited lattice and beyond, and how can viewers can get involved?
Guests:
Diane Peruggia, Chair of the Staten Island Developmental Disabilities Council
Sebastian Chittilappilly, Chief of Programs at CP Unlimited
Marleen Whitman, Director of Day Services at the Cora Hoffman Center
